Dam 18 (Quedlinburg)
Haus Damm 18 is a listed building in the city of Quedlinburg in Saxony-Anhalt .
location
It is located in the northern part of the street dam and is a UNESCO World Heritage Site . It is registered as a residential building in the Quedlinburg monument register. To the north, the also listed building borders Damm 19 .
Architecture and history
The two-storey baroque half-timbered house was built around 1740. There is a profile plank on the threshold of the building . A redesign has recently taken place. Inside the house there is a two-part door in front of the wide front door.
On the courtyard side there is a small-scale half-timbered development.
